Citizen Advisory Committee: Call for applications

March 11, 2025 by Kent County Public Schools Leave a Comment

Share

Kent County Public Schools is accepting applications for anyone interested in serving on the Citizen Advisory Committee.

The Citizen Advisory Committee (CAC) is a structured group that meets about specific issues impacting educational policy, activities and programs. The CAC may also respond to requests from the Kent County Board of Education for research and recommendations on specific educational issues.

New members will be appointed to a two-year term that will begin July 1.
